The Mercedes-Benz E-Class E 500 Cabriolet is a convertible powered by a petrol engine delivering 388 hp (285 kW). It accelerates from 0 to 100 km/h in 5.3 s and reaches a top speed of 250 km/h. Fuel efficiency stands at 11.0 l/100 km combined, CO₂ emissions of 257 g/km. Drive is routed to the rear-wheel-drive axle via an automatic. This variant was introduced in 2010 as part of the Mercedes-Benz E-Class Cabriolet (2010-2013) generation, and sits alongside 3 other variants in this generation.
